ProbabilityTheory.Kernel.IsProper.setLIntegral_eq_comp
∀ {X : Type u_1} {𝓑 𝓧 : MeasurableSpace X} {π : ProbabilityTheory.Kernel X X} {A B : Set X},
π.IsProper →
𝓑 ≤ 𝓧 →
∀ {μ : MeasureTheory.Measure X},
MeasurableSet A → MeasurableSet B → ∫⁻ (a : X) in B, (π a) A ∂μ = (μ.bind ⇑π) (A ∩ B)- Defined in
- Mathlib.Probability.Kernel.Proper
